Study Summary
The primary objectives of this trial are: * To evaluate the effect of a high-calorie, high-fat meal on the single-dose pharmacokinetics (PK) of milademetan * To evaluate the effect of a standard meal on the single-dose PK of milademetan The key secondary objective is to evaluate the safety and tolerability of single-dose milademetan in all treatments. The duration of the study for each individual participant will be approximately 8 weeks from the start of Screening (within 28 days prior to dosing of study drug on Day 1) through the final Follow-up visit or phone call. Participants will remain in the Clinical Research Unit (CRU) from Study Day -2 through Study Day 20 (a total of 22 days and 21 nights). Participants will receive 3 single doses of study drug (at least 1 week apart) over the course of 15 days. At the investigator's discretion, participants may be asked to return to the CRU 14 days (±2 days) after final dose of study drug for a follow-up visit. The end of the study is defined as the date of final follow-up visit of the last subject undergoing the study.
